Directions:

1

Preheat the oven to 350 degrees F

2

Line a regular cupcake or muffin pan with 12 cupcake liners

3

Sift the flour, baking powder, salt, 1/4 teaspoon black pepper and cayenne pepper into a medium bowl

4

Set the bowl aside

5

In a small bowl, combine the tomato juice, 1/4 cup vodka, lemon juice, hot sauce and Worcestershire sauce

6

Set the bowl aside

7

In the bowl of an electric stand mixer with a paddle attachment, cream the butter with the granulated sugar and horseradish sauce, about 5 minutes

8

Scrape down the sides of the bowl, and then add 1 egg at a time, scraping down the sides of the bowl after each addition

9

Turn the mixer to the lowest speed and add the flour and tomato juice mixtures, alternating between the two, beginning and ending with the flour

10

Mix until just combined

11

Scrape down the sides and mix for 30 seconds

12

Fill the cupcake liners three-quarters full with batter and bake until baked through, 15 to 18 minutes

13

In a small bowl, combine the remaining 2 tablespoons vodka and remaining 1/4 teaspoon black pepper

14

Use a pastry brush to brush the vodka mixture over the warm cupcakes

15

Cool the cupcakes completely, about 30 minutes

16

Put the Cayenne Pepper Buttercream into a pastry bag and cut 1/2-inch off the tip

17

Frost the cupcakes once they are completely cool

18

Top with your favorite sprinkles or decoration

19

Sift the powdered sugar into a medium bowl

20

In the bowl of an electric stand mixer with a paddle attachment, cream the butter and celery salt together, about 1 minute

21

Then add the powdered sugar and milk, alternating between the two

22

Beat until combined

23

Scrape the sides of the bowl

24

Add the lemon juice, vanilla and cayenne pepper

25

Mix until combined

26

Then beat the mixture on high until light and fluffy, 5 to 6 minutes

27

Yield: about 2 cups
